Being In Awe Inspires Leadership
Thoughts on Awe…
"If you’re not in awe, you’re not paying attention.” Mary Oliver
The world is a miraculous place. There are marvels at every turn. Whether it be watching a hummingbird feed from a flower, the smile of an infant or a universal TV remote, there are wonders in view all of the time. To see them requires a person to be present, open, and connected. To appreciate them requires, a sense of wonder, humility, and gratitude. Doing so can turn a normal day into a seemingly magical wonderland. As for me, I’m in awe most of the time. At this moment I’m in awe of how a color printer works, as well as the juicy-ness of a fresh summer peach. Don’t get me started…I could go on:)
World-class leaders view the world with a sense of awe and gratitude. Followed closely by a quest to discover and learn. This is a contagious energy that can ripple through a team and a business inspiring creativity and a culture that invites appreciation and gratitude. It ultimately creates a safe environment where team members will step into leadership and share more of themselves and big ideas. Who doesn’t want to invest in a team or business that oozes gratitude and appreciation.
